Node.js開發者還在老老實實部署環境?速度來體驗阿里雲平臺WEB開發最新玩法!

Ali_D發表於2020-05-07

阿里 雲開發平臺通用web開發 的深入分析

前言 作為一名程式開發愛好者,也加入阿里社群一段時間了,很高興也很榮幸加入這個有活力有技術的開發社群團隊,這裡能接觸國內前沿的技術乾貨,也能瞭解接觸阿里技術大牛,作為技術汪的自己深感榮幸,借用竊格瓦拉一句話“這裡的人都是人才,講話又好聽,我超級喜歡這裡,哈哈 ~ ”,以下是我對阿里雲開發平臺通用 Web開發的一些個人解析。

一、 雲平臺通用web 開發體驗

透過阿里雲社群體驗步驟引導很輕鬆的就能建立自己的專案產品,建立自己的團隊,配置自己的倉庫和環境管理步驟如圖:

訪問阿里云云開發平臺


 

進入應用

 


這裡場景選擇 WEB ,解決方案選擇 Ali Midway Faas 一體化解決方案(for NodeJS10),選擇完成配置好環境就可以進入開發Cloud IDE了:

 

 

小結:建立應用到開發整體流程阿里社群步驟十分詳細,小白都可以輕鬆入手,很贊,作為開發者上手簡直是不費力。

二、 開發 web 技術解析

關於阿里線上開發Cloud IDE,是一款強大的線上開發環境IDE 功能強大,類似於 TextMate/Sublime,編輯流暢。自帶的Box裡面有Open-JDK7, ANT, Maven等,可以支援Java的Build/Run,支援自帶Language的debug。可以開多個Shell(Alt+T), 但是實際用Alt+T開Shell有BUG,經常開啟失敗,只能用自帶的那個Shell(F6)。可以打包下載workspace,可以上傳檔案和目錄。因為平時我開發主要語言用python,這塊線上IDE還不是常用,看到Cloud IDE趕緊讓我眼前一亮,最方便的是有效解決本地環境問題,需要的依賴直接從指定倉庫拉取即可。

開發web語言Node.js,因為此次體驗選擇的解決方案是Node.js,關於Node.js 簡單的說 Node.js 就是執行在服務端的 JavaScript。

Node.js 是一個基於Chrome JavaScript 執行時建立的一個平臺。

Node.js是一個事件驅動I/O服務端JavaScript環境,基於Google的V8引擎,V8引擎執行Javascript的速度非常快,效能非常好 ,非常建議 Node.js開發工作者和學習者使用阿里雲社群的web應用開發自己想要的專案。

三、 整體體驗感受

在整體建立應用到具體的開發前準備都很順利,下載準備開發依賴也很順利,

但是第二步# 啟動 react 本地 watch 和 函式本地 Dev Server# 在終端中會輸出 本地 Dev Server 的URL連結   使用npm run dev 命令式總是會先錯誤,不知道是哪裡出了問題,畢竟不是專業學node.js 的這些bug不是太明白,希望Node.js的大神可以知道一下為什麼會報這樣的錯誤

 

四、總結:

整體的體驗步驟下來感覺步驟清晰明瞭,很適合新手開發者去嘗試和體驗,依賴的安裝和環境的準備很簡單方便,省去了搭建環境的費時苦惱,因為非Node.js 專業的開發者在實際專案的開發當中難免會遇到看不懂的 bug, 但是相信對於專業的 Node.js 的開發和愛好者利用阿里雲平臺提供的平臺開發簡直是如虎添翼,最後真心安利各位開發者體驗使用阿里雲平臺產品,讓你的開發之路順利有多彩!

            


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69973762/viewspace-2690488/,如需轉載,請註明出處,否則將追究法律責任。

相關文章